Formal verification proofs, within the context of c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, represent mathematically rigorous demonstrations that a system or protocol behaves as intended. These proofs leverage formal methods, employing logic and mathematical techniques to exhaustively examine code and specifications, ensuring correctness and absence of vulnerabilities. Unlike traditional testing, which relies on finite samples, formal verification aims to prove properties across all possible states, offering a significantly higher degree of assurance regarding system behavior, particularly crucial in high-value financial applications. The increasing complexity of dec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ols and derivatives necessitates robust verification techniques to mitigate risks associated with smart contract errors and market manipulation.
